Preaching the Gospel with Steph Vogelman '19

Steph Vogelman, who graduated in May of 2019, is participating in a year-long service program with FrancisCorps in Syracuse, NY. Steph serves as an outreach worker at the the Downtown Cathedral Emergency and Hospitality Services.  She assists in the operation of the emergency service and practical assistance office, a food pantry and hospitality center for people who are experiencing homelessness.
